## Symptom
In `react-scan@0.5.7`, overlay UI utilities that rely on Tailwind v4's `translate` / `rotate` / `scale` shorthand render incorrectly. The most visible symptom is the outline-render toggle switch: in the OFF state the white thumb pops out of the track and hangs below it. The same class of bug affects the resize handles, slider thumb, and expand arrow — anywhere the overlay CSS uses `@apply -translate-*` / `translate-*`.
Reproduction on Chrome 149 with a Tailwind v4 host (also reproduces with a non-Tailwind host, verified against a Panda CSS project — the host stylesheet is irrelevant since the overlay is inside a shadow DOM).
Downgrading to `react-scan@0.5.6` restores correct rendering (v0.5.6 is on Tailwind v3, which uses preflight-seeded `--tw-translate-*` rather than `@property`).

## Root cause
React Scan mounts its overlay UI in a shadow DOM and injects the bundled Tailwind stylesheet as a `` element inside that shadow root ([`packages/scan/src/core/index.ts`](https://github.com/aidenybai/react-scan/blob/main/packages/scan/src/core/index.ts#L33-L51)). Tailwind v3 → v4 in 0.5.7 changed how `-translate-y-1/2` etc. compile: instead of the preflight-seeded `--tw-translate-*` variables, v4 emits 62 `@property` rules to declare the `initial-value` (0).
Chromium does not register `@property` rules declared inside a shadow-DOM stylesheet. The CSSOM parses them into `CSSPropertyRule`s (visible via `stylesheet.cssRules`), but the custom-property registry is empty for that shadow tree. Consequently `--tw-translate-x` has no computed value, and
```css
translate: var(--tw-translate-x) var(--tw-translate-y);
```
collapses to `translate: none`.
Measurement on `.react-scan-toggle > div::before` in the OFF state (react-scan 0.5.7, Chrome 149):
| property | value |
| --- | --- |
| `translate` | `none` |
| `--tw-translate-x` | `""` (empty) |
| `--tw-translate-y` | `calc(calc(1 / 2 * 100%) * -1)` |
For the ON state, the `input:checked + div::before` selector applies `translate-x-full` which explicitly sets `--tw-translate-x: 100%`, so translate resolves — that's why the ON state visually looks OK while OFF is broken.
Document-level `@property` registrations *do* cascade into a shadow tree, verified in a minimal repro on Chrome 149.
Spec: [CSS Properties and Values API L1](https://drafts.css-houdini.org/css-properties-values-api/).
## Proposed fix (branch available)
I have a one-file fix on my fork:
[`hidenari-pixel/react-scan@fix/shadow-dom-property-registration`](https://github.com/hidenari-pixel/react-scan/tree/fix/shadow-dom-property-registration) ([diff](https://github.com/aidenybai/react-scan/compare/main...hidenari-pixel:react-scan:fix/shadow-dom-property-registration))
Approach: in `initRootContainer()`, extract every `@property --…{…}` block from the bundled overlay CSS with a regex before injecting the stylesheet into the shadow root, and mount just those rules under a `<style data-react-scan="property-registrations">` in `document.head`. The remainder still goes into the shadow root as before.
After the fix, the same `::before` in the OFF state resolves to:
| property | value |
| --- | --- |
| `translate` | `0px -50%` |
| `--tw-translate-x` | `0` |
| `--tw-translate-y` | `calc(calc(1 / 2 * 100%) * -1)` |
and 62/62 `@property` rules move from the shadow tree to `document.head`.
- Change is ~14 lines in `packages/scan/src/core/index.ts` plus a changeset entry
- `pnpm --filter react-scan build` succeeds
- `pnpm test:e2e` — 47/47 pass, including the outline toggle instrumentation specs from #459
- Manual verification in `kitchen-sink` on Chrome 149: toggle thumb renders centered in both OFF and ON states
